Forming part of this small modern development within the village of Southbourne, Treagust & Co is pleased to offer this shared ownership home with shares available from 50% (depending on affordability). The property is also available to purchase as 100% freehold to interested parties.

This well presented property benefits from two allocated parking spaces, a west facing rear garden and photovoltaic solar panels providing free energy to the home.

A partially glazed composite front door opens into the entrance hall with staircase to the first floor with storage cupboard beneath and a cloakroom. The front aspect kitchen is fitted with a range of modern units with wood effect work surfaces over, and has a built-in oven, hob & extractor, with further planned appliance space. Set to the rear of the home overlooking the west facing rear garden is the sitting room with French doors opening out.

Upstairs the landing has a cupboard housing the wall mounted Glow-worm boiler with slatted shelving below. There are two double bedrooms with the rear aspect room benefiting from built-in storage and the front aspect room having recessed space for wardrobes. Completing the accommodation is the family bathroom fitted with a white suite with shower over the bath.

Outside
At the front of the property there are two allocated parking spaces. A side gate provides access to the west facing landscaped garden which features two paved seating areas linked by a central pathway bordered by lawn. There is a garden shed, outside lighting, power point and tap.

The Area
The village of Southbourne is approximately six miles to the east of the Cathedral city of Chichester with its famous Festival Theatre and nearby Goodwood estate. The harbour foreshore is easily accessed at Prinsted, an ideal spot for watersports with lots of lovely walks to be enjoyed. A good range of local amenities are in Southbourne, including convenience stores, churches, doctors' surgery, and a gym and sports hall. The village has primary and secondary schools, good bus links between Brighton and Portsmouth, and a railway station with links to the south coast, London, and further afield.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
